The first Libera Terra cooperative in Campania, created in 2010 on land and a former cheese dairy confiscated from the Casalesi clan in Castel Volturno. It organically farms around eighty hectares spread across five municipalities in the province of Caserta and produces what is known as the mozzarella of legality. It bears the name of the priest Peppe Diana, murdered by the camorra in 1994 for publicly denouncing the collusion between the mafia and local politics.
